Namanyere serves as the administrative centre of the Nkasi District in the Rukwa Region of Tanzania. Situated in a region defined by its rugged landscape and proximity to the Rukwa valley, the area is characterized by sprawling rural expanses and a climate conducive to traditional farming practices. The surrounding countryside presents a mix of fertile plains and rolling terrain, providing a natural setting that supports diverse agricultural land use.
The economy of the area is heavily dependent on agriculture, with the majority of the population engaged in small-scale farming. Key crops cultivated in the vicinity include maize, beans, sunflowers, and finger millet, which are essential for both food security and local income. Livestock keeping is also a significant activity, with farmers maintaining herds of cattle, goats, and sheep, which integrate well into the local farming systems, providing manure for crops and additional sustenance for households.
